Introduction
Rural road safety remains one of the most pressing public health and infrastructure challenges in low-resource areas worldwide. Despite lower traffic density, rural roads often experience disproportionately high accident rates due to inadequate infrastructure, lack of signage, poor road maintenance, and limited emergency response services.
